Default Silverstone's new tower comes in two flavors

Computex — Like Silverstone's Micro ATX Temjin TJ08-E chassis but wish it could hold full-sized motherboards? Good news. The TJ08-E's foundation has grown to accommodate ATX systems. Silverstone will be offering this new tower in two distinctly different flavors, both of which share the same internal structure.

The cases offer dual 180-mm fans up front and one 120-mm spinner at the rear.
